Are there any famous fictional characters named Shada?
While Shada may not be widely recognized in popular fiction, it has appeared in various forms of media. For example, "Shada" is the title of an unfinished Doctor Who story, which has gained a cult following among fans of the series. This connection adds a layer of intrigue to the name within certain fandoms.
